The Water's Fine is this quiet, introspective film that dives into family dynamics and unresolved tensions. Set against the backdrop of a rustic family cottage, it really captures that heavy atmosphere of nostalgia mixed with disappointment. The pacing is deliberate, allowing you to soak in the nuances of the characters' interactions. The young lead gives a raw performance that feels both vulnerable and relatable, making you root for her despite the awkwardness around her. It’s not flashy at all, no big special effects—just the weight of familial estrangement that hangs in the air. It’s a slice-of-life that feels almost like a personal diary, exploring themes of connection and the often-painful process of reconciling the past.
